Transaction 1758fa8ce9f9598da5edb49918d8ae50998435585e02b430762314c61fd56706
1 Input
1 Output
-
1758fa8ce9f9598da5edb49918d8ae50998435585e02b430762314c61fd56706:0
- value
- 526891
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51e507fa5e7501b88f829a39546976112e52e2d7 OP_EQUAL
- address
- 39A32SqXqGgEUWvwBVA369TsyUNwM6j2Do